Western National Named to 2022 Ward’s Top 50

Western National was once again named to the Ward's 50 Benchmark Group of top performing U.S. property-and-casualty companies. Being named to this group recognizes Western National for achieving outstanding financial results in the areas of safety, consistency, and performance over a five-year period (2017 – 2021). Inclusion in this elite group of top performing property-and-casualty insurance companies reinforces the continued financial strength and stability of Western National Insurance Group. Second Quarter Financials

Through June 30, 2022, written premium for our Group (not including affiliate Michigan Millers) is at $428.3 million – which puts us in a good position for the second half of the year from a premium standpoint. Our loss ratio is 59.2% (vs. goal of 52.9%), our loss adjustment expense ratio is 10.5% (vs. goal of 10.8%), and our underwriting expense ratio is 28.9% (vs. goal of 30.8%) – adding up to a combined ratio of 98.5%. Not surprisingly, the storm activity in recent months has impacted these numbers. We are hoping for a less eventful second half of the year so we can improve some of these numbers.

Recent Recognitions and Designations

In addition to being named to this year’s Ward’s Top 50, Western National has received several other recognitions. Earlier this summer, Western National was named one of the Star Tribune’s Top 200 Workplaces in Minnesota. Top Workplaces recognizes the most progressive companies in Minnesota based on employee opinions measuring engagement, organizational health, and satisfaction.

 

For three years, we have retained our gold-level Green Business Award from the city of Edina where our Minnesota office is located. This recognition acknowledges and celebrates businesses that have taken actions to become more environmentally responsible in their day-to-day operations.

 

In recognition of our well-being initiatives at our offices, we have been named an mspWellness Champion. This designation celebrates organizations that work to positively affect the health and well-being of their employees and communities.
